WebJun 4, 2024 · Microsoft Windows RDP can allow an attacker to bypass the lock screen on remote sessions. Description In Windows a session can be locked, which presents the user with a screen that requires authentication to continue using the session. Session locking can happen over RDP in the same way that a local session can be locked.
